Full Moon in Aquarius opposing the Leo Sun

A dream you dream alone is only a dream. A dream you dream together is reality. - John Lennon

The Aquarius Full Moon on July 31st at 10:43am Universal Time opposes the Sun and Venus in Leo alighting our awareness of the celebration of self within the context of our hopes and desires in the larger world. Leo is impeccably self-possessed, full of light and joy (perhaps excessive, perhaps not) and hungry for validation of the crowd for the sharing of its special gifts. It is a fiery, resilient sign and while no sign may be more prideful or apt to feel bruised now and again when their delicate egos are poked, Leo types can usually bounce back and a fill a room with their fabulous being-ness.

With the Moon directly across the sky in Aquarius, our own Leo-ness is finding its place in the spotlight and we are asked to shine in whatever capacity we feel so called (You can look to your chart to see what house Leo rules for a better idea of what area of life is calling upon your powers of self). With Venus in Leo conjunct the Sun, our desires are highlighted and the trick seems to be how to boldly go after what we want in a way that honors our connection to the larger world as well as the sort of community we want to support and nurture in the future. Of course, how to do this is a very personal reflection and Leo the Aquarius polarity is much more comfortable in taking action than wasting time daydreaming. You may find yourself in a position to take action from the vantage point of these two sides of life. How can I celebrate myself and honor my relationships? It's a trickier balance than you may suspect but the price tag is being highlighted with the cosmic line-up. Lack of clarity is no longer an excuse!

The Full Moon in Aquarius, while righteously raucous and refreshingly celebratory, may bring to light the tension between what we desire and what is ethical within a larger context. An appreciation of our self is mandatory but we have to remember that everything we do has a ripple and to use the power and brightness afforded us by the Sun in Leo to stay in touch with that part of ourselves that knows it's all a game, that part of ourselves that can live without validation of the crowd, and that can ultimately serve a better world far outside the realm of personal vanity. The Aquarius Moon is often talked about as being "rebellious," but more importantly it's about being bold enough to follow your own beliefs and direction even if the "herd" isn't buying it yet. When the Moon is in Aquarius it's important for us to tune into our own unique sense of ethics and follow what feels distinctly right for us. There doesn't have to be a contradiction of course, but if there is ... this is the time to find out.

This Full Moon we are asked at once to stand within our own power and observe it as if we are an outsider, taking stock of what is needed to bolster our role for everyone. If we are serving ourselves and those around us (and with Aquarius, it's a pretty wide circumference) - even if that means yes, just spreading the LOVE - then we have found the sweet spot of this awesome configuration.
